Kinds Of Fluid Waste



Understanding the different types of fluid waste is crucial for reliable management and disposal practices. Liquid waste can be extensively classified right into a number of kinds, each requiring special handling and treatment methods.


Industrial fluid waste typically includes unsafe products, including hefty steels, solvents, and chemicals, generated during producing processes. These wastes necessitate rigorous regulative conformity to secure human wellness and the environment. Residential liquid waste primarily describes wastewater produced from families, consisting of sewer and greywater, which, although less poisonous, can still present significant dangers if incorrectly handled.


Agricultural fluid waste, including runoff from farms, typically consists of plant foods and pesticides that can bring about environmental deterioration if not treated sufficiently. Medical liquid waste, generated from medical care centers, includes contaminated liquids such as bodily liquids and chemicals, requiring specialized disposal techniques to stop infection and ecological contamination.


Lastly, oil and grease waste, generally produced by restaurants and auto markets, can trigger severe clogs in sewer systems otherwise handled effectively. Recognizing these classifications assists in targeted approaches for therapy, conformity with regulations, and efficient disposal approaches, ultimately promoting ecological sustainability and public wellness safety and security.

Collection Techniques



Efficient collection techniques are important for the proper management of liquid waste, making certain that it is gathered securely and efficiently before therapy or disposal. Numerous methods are employed depending on the kind of fluid waste created, the quantity, and the specific features of the waste.


One common approach is the use of dedicated collection storage tanks or sumps, which are designed to catch liquid waste at the resource. These systems typically include pumps that help with the transfer of waste to larger storage space containers or treatment centers. In addition, mobile collection units outfitted with vacuum cleaner technology are utilized in circumstances where waste is generated intermittently or in hard-to-reach places.


For commercial setups, closed-loop systems can properly lessen leakages and spills, permitting for the recovery and reuse of liquid waste. It is likewise vital to train employees on correct collection procedures to minimize risks linked with dangerous compounds.


In addition, executing normal maintenance timetables for collection tools makes sure optimum performance and safety and security. The assimilation of advanced tracking systems can improve collection efficiency by offering real-time data on waste levels and prospective risks. On the whole, efficient collection approaches are fundamental to sustainable fluid waste monitoring methods.


Treatment Processes



Therapy processes play an important role in the management of fluid waste, changing potentially unsafe products into recyclable resources or secure effluents - liquid waste disposal. These processes can be generally classified into physical, chemical, and biological techniques, each customized to attend to certain contaminants existing in the waste stream


Physical treatment approaches, such as sedimentation and filtration, job by removing put on hold solids and particulate matter. These techniques are frequently the very first step in the therapy chain, effectively decreasing the lots on subsequent processes. Chemical therapies include using reagents to neutralize dangerous substances, precipitate hefty steels, or oxidize natural toxins, therefore improving the safety of the effluent.




Organic therapy procedures, including activated sludge systems and anaerobic food digestion, exploit on the natural capacities of microorganisms to deteriorate organic matter. These techniques are specifically efficient for wastewater containing naturally degradable contaminants. Advanced therapy modern technologies, such as membrane layer purification and advanced oxidation procedures, are significantly used to accomplish greater degrees of purification.

Ecological Effect



The environmental impact of liquid garbage disposal is a crucial consideration for organizations seeking to lessen their environmental impact. Incorrect disposal approaches can lead to substantial contamination of water resources, soil deterioration, and negative results on local ecosystems. For instance, hazardous fluids can seep right into groundwater, posing dangers to alcohol consumption water supplies and water life. Furthermore, the discharge of untreated or improperly treated waste into surface area waters can cause eutrophication, resulting in oxygen depletion and the subsequent death of fish and various other microorganisms.
